When Jiang Xia heard An Ning shout, he knew what she meant. He just gave her a disdainful look and said, "You need this young master just to dig up some grass?"
"Hurry up."
An Ning only said those two words, and Jiang Xia reluctantly went over.
"When are you going to fix that bleeding-heart flaw of yours? Aren’t you afraid someone’s going to sell you out?"
"And when are you going to fix that smart mouth of yours? Or you’ll end up dead fast."
Their eyes met, clashing in a silent, mutual show of disdain.
Then, they both looked away at the same time, their gazes falling to the ginseng under the withered tree.
"There are a few of them."
Jiang Xia crouched down, his interest piqued. He started clearing away some dirt with his hands and pulled a red string from his waistband.
"What’s that for?"
An Ning didn’t understand.
Jiang Xia held up the red string. "This is called respecting the wisdom of our ancestors."
"Just like how you fear ghosts."
Having his weakness exposed, Jiang Xia wasn’t the least bit embarrassed. He even said with a straight face, "You should revere ghosts and spirits."
An Ning didn’t ask any more questions. She crouched down and copied Jiang Xia’s movements, helping him dig away the soil.
Jiang Xia didn’t let it show on his face, but he knew he was very relaxed around An Ning. ’After all, things like ghosts and spirits aren’t something one can talk about so easily. Though that era had passed, the caution ingrained in people’s bones hadn’t faded.’
Together, they dug up three ginseng roots. One was very large, and the other two were smaller and about the same size.
"I’ll take one, the rest are yours."
Jiang Xia said, pointing to one of the smaller ones. An Ning had no objection; that was how she would have divided them too.
The two of them tied the fresh ginseng with the red string, wrapped them in leaves, and then added another layer of cloth before they were satisfied.
They continued deeper into the mountains. They hadn’t hunted anything on their way in; if they couldn’t find the deer herd, they could just hunt on their way down.
Jiang Xia was very familiar with everything in the mountains, and he wasn’t stingy with his knowledge, teaching An Ning as they went.
An Ning was genuinely interested. One taught quickly and the other learned quickly, and both of them enjoyed the process.
This teaching experience even gave An Ning a strange thought: ’I guess this is what it’s like to teach someone.’
Partway through their journey, they found a spot to rest. Jiang Xia took out a few large flatbreads, toasted them briefly over a fire, and the two ate them with a can of luncheon meat.
After their meal, Jiang Xia extinguished the fire, checked it several times, and covered it with dirt before they continued on their way.
Soon, they found tracks from the deer herd and picked up their pace.
That evening, they found the herd.
"Now, or wait until tomorrow?" 𝐟𝚛𝕖𝚎𝕨𝗲𝐛𝚗𝐨𝐯𝐞𝕝.𝐜𝗼𝗺
Jiang Xia glanced at the situation. "Tomorrow. It’s too dark. Humans are no match for animals at night."
"Okay."
An Ning had no objection. ’Although my spiritual power would make this a piece of cake, there’s no need to reveal it. Especially not to Jiang Xia. That guy is too clever.’
They found a spot sheltered from the wind where they could observe the herd without getting too cold.
That night, An Ning rested first while Jiang Xia kept watch. In the latter half of the night, Jiang Xia slept for a while as An Ning took over.
After midnight, before the sky lightened, the deer herd began to move.
An Ning and Jiang Xia moved as well.
They followed behind the herd. When the deer entered a narrow path, the two of them sped up. An Ning was in the lead, launching an attack on the last deer in the line.
A single strike was fatal, giving it no chance to struggle.
Repeating the same maneuver, they took down four deer before stopping and quietly slipping away.
"I want the deer antlers."
"No problem."
Jiang Xia guessed they were for An Ning’s sister-in-law and readily agreed.
"You can take an extra deer."
An Ning was fair and didn’t want to take advantage of him.
They were partners, not enemies.
"No need. We’ll split the money from the meat fifty-fifty. Besides, these two don’t have any external wounds, so their blood will sell for a good price."
The two fashioned a simple rig and carried the four deer down the mountain.
This time, when they came down the mountain, they weren’t far from Sanhe Town.
"Fatty’s place again?"
"I’m fine with that."
Working together, the two of them brought the four deer to Fatty’s place.
When Fatty saw the four deer, he smiled so broadly his eyes vanished into slits.
"I was wondering why I saw a magpie this morning! Turns out it was because you two were on your way."
Fatty had realized that his most profitable business always came from these two.
He even wondered if he should swap out the face on his God of Wealth statue for theirs. ’The two of them would be a perfect fit.’
An Ning and Jiang Xia barely said a word, both wearing the same cold expression.
One was calmly cold, the other arrogantly so.
Fatty looked at the two of them, standing there like a pair of Door Gods, and griped internally: ’You two look way too much like a married couple.’
Of course, he only dared to think it.
He didn’t know much else about these two big shots, but he knew that with their combined strength, they could kill him as easily as swatting a fly.
The two of them sold the four deer for 2,980 yuan.
Deer were very expensive because every part of them was valuable.
They took the money, An Ning kept one of the deer antlers, and they left Fatty’s territory together.
"Hey, do you want to get that deer antler processed?"
"You know how?"
Jiang Xia immediately shot back, "I don’t."
"But I know someone who does."
An Ning looked at Jiang Xia’s expression and felt an urge to laugh.
"Your expression tells me you’re more confident than the person who actually knows how to do it."
At that, Jiang Xia put on his arrogant "young master" air again, snapping impatiently, "So, do you want it done or not?"
"Do it."
An Ning handed the deer antler straight to Jiang Xia and said coolly, "Bring it to me when it’s ready."
"Hey, hey, hey! Is that any way to ask someone for a favor?"
An Ning, who had her back to him, turned around and said, "I didn’t ask you."
An Ning turned away again, a faint, triumphant smile on her face, and started walking toward the hospital.
Left standing there, Jiang Xia placed the deer antler into a basket, secured it, and scratched his head with one hand.
’Wait, I was the one who offered, wasn’t I? Dammit.’
In the end, Jiang Xia still took the deer antler to have it professionally prepared, repeatedly reminding the person to do a good job.
Meanwhile, An Ning arrived at the town hospital. After speaking with the doctor, she checked in with her sister-in-law and Lin Cuihua. Lin Cuihua immediately decided she wanted to go home.
"We were just waiting for you to get back. We wanted to head home yesterday."
Lin Cuihua started packing their things, while An Ning went out with a smile to find a vehicle to take her sister-in-law home.
In the end, the three of them went back in an ox-cart. It was slow, but relatively steady.
After getting home, An Ning put away her money from the hunt, gave the smaller ginseng root to her older brother An Guoqing, and explained how to use it.
She had asked the doctor about it at the hospital earlier.
"Little sister—"
An Guoqing was deeply moved.
’His little sister had gone into the mountains for them. She’d gone to find ginseng for them.’
"As long as you’re all healthy, that’s what matters. I’m waiting to hold my nephew or niece, you know."
An Ning then gave the larger ginseng root to An Sancheng, letting him decide whether to sell it or keep it for the family.
"We’ll keep it. This stuff is more precious than money."
"Oh, right. I’ve finished distributing the money. Your big brother’s family got their share, and even your little brother got some. This portion is yours. Put it away safely."
An Ning looked at the money An Sancheng pushed toward her and didn’t refuse.
She returned to her room and put all the money away in her cabinet.
For a time, things were quiet at the An family’s home. Her sister-in-law rested and focused on her pregnancy, and Lin Cuihua was anything but stingy, preparing a different variety of meals for her every day.
Their peaceful life continued until the college entrance exam scores were released.
